Background
The seedling raising means the raising of seedlings. The original meaning is that the seedlings are cultivated in a nursery, a hotbed or a greenhouse and are ready to be transplanted into the land for planting. It can also refer to the stage of various organisms after artificial protection until they can survive independently. In common words, "the seedling is strong and half harvested". The seedling culture is a work with high labor intensity, time consumption and strong technical performance.
The seedling raising field is arranged in a place where traffic is convenient, the land is flat and wide, water is not accumulated, water sources and power sources exist, and the environmental conditions of the seedling raising field need to meet the requirements of pollution-free production. And simultaneously meets the requirements of facilities such as a seedling raising shed and the like according to the seedling raising scale.
The existing seedling raising shed is generally formed by splicing skeletons, the skeletons are respectively dispersed and stored inconveniently, the skeletons are scattered and placed in a warehouse, the occupied area is large, the skeletons are carelessly lost easily, one of the skeletons is fixed on the ground when the skeletons are reused, and then the skeletons are covered with plastic, so that the seedling raising shed is inconvenient to use, and the skeletons are not provided with fixing mechanisms and are not firm enough.

In conjunction with FIGS. 1-3:
a vegetable seedling raising shed comprises a plurality of main bodies 1, the main bodies 1 are mutually connected through chains 6, the main body 1 comprises an upper support frame 2 and a lower support frame 3, the upper support frame 2 and the lower support frame 3 are both provided with a connecting groove 31, a connecting plate 41 is hinged in the connecting groove 31, a fixing hole 33 is arranged at the outer side of the lower support frame 3, the top of the connecting plate 41 is provided with a connecting hole 43, a fixing nail 34 is fixedly connected in the fixing hole 33, the tail of the fixing nail 34 passes through the fixing hole 33 to be fixedly connected in the connecting hole 43, after the main bodies 1 are connected with each other through the chain 6, the connecting plate 41 of one main body 1 rotates in the connecting groove 31 to be horizontal to the ground, rotates in the fastening groove 35 of the other main body 1, and the fixing nail 34 passes through the fixing hole 33 and is fixedly connected in the connecting plate 41 of the main body 1, so that the fixed connection between the two main bodies 1 is completed.
In this embodiment, the long sides of the connecting slots 31 of the upper support frame 2 are parallel to the ground, and the long sides of the connecting slots 31 of the lower support frame 3 are perpendicular to the ground.
In this embodiment, the upper support frame 2 is arched.
In this embodiment, the bottom of the lower supporting frame 3 is fixedly connected with a positioning block 5, and the positioning block 5 is fixedly connected with a positioning nail 51.
In this embodiment, the bottom of the connecting groove 31 is provided with a rotating groove 32, the bottom of the connecting plate 41 is fixedly connected with a connecting column 42, and the connecting column 42 is connected in the rotating groove 32 through a bearing.
In this embodiment, the corners of the upper support frame 2 are rounded.
In this embodiment, the positioning pin 51 forms an angle of 85 ° with the horizontal plane.
In this embodiment, there are three main bodies 1.
In this embodiment, the front surface of the main body 1 is fixedly connected with a connecting block 61, and two ends of the chain 6 are fixedly connected to the connecting block 61.
This device will educate seedling shed's skeleton split into a plurality of main part, and these main parts prevent to lose some part when storing through the chain connection to be provided with the connecting plate between each main part, in the main part is placed to the connecting plate when storing, do not occupy extra area, when using, the connecting plate struts, strengthens seedling shed's intensity, prevents to damage.
